##mysql字段类型1、tinyint、smallint、mediumint、int、integer、bigint详解1)tinyint:存储所占一个字节,一个字节等于8bit,根据1bit可以存储0到1两种可能性,因此tinyint类型可以存储28次方,也就是256种可能性,从0开始计数,无符号也就是可以 存储0 ~ 255,如果是有符号,那就是-128 ~ 127。 即 注: tinyin
# MySQL页、科普解析 ## 简介 MySQL是一个广泛使用开源关系型数据库管理系统,它支持多种存储引擎,其中最常用引擎是InnoDB。在了解MySQL存储引擎之前,我们需要先了解一些基本概念,包括页、。 ## 页 在MySQL中,页是存储引擎管理数据最小单位。一般情况下,页大小为16KB。各个存储引擎大小可能会有所不同,但一般不会超过64KB。页是磁盘和内存
原创 2023-10-31 09:38:06
54阅读
索引组织表(IOT表):为什么引入索引组织表,好处在那里,组织结构特点是什么,如何创建,创建IOT限制LIMIT。 IOT是以索引方式存储表,表记录存储在索引中,索引即是数据,索引KEY为PRIMARY KEY。数据查询可以通过查询索引同时查询到数据,因为索引和数据存储在一个数据块中,
原创 2021-07-19 17:16:35
566阅读
最近一直看到页区段概念,这里先简单整理一下。表空间由 (segment)、(extent)、页(page)组成。Page(页)每个表空间由数据库页组成,它是InnoDB存储引擎磁盘管理最小单位,文档上表示是它代表InnoDB任何时候在磁盘(数据文件)和内存(缓冲池)之间传输数据单位。MySQL实例中每个表空间都有相同页大小。默认情况下,所有表空间页大小为16KB,页大小可以通过i
转载 2023-08-20 20:55:58
132阅读
B+树每一层中页都会形成一个双向链表,如果是以页为单位来分配存储空间的话,双
原创 2022-10-02 00:01:54
37阅读
目录1、表空间和数据概念 表空间(segment)(extent)页(page)总结1、表空间和数据概念 表空间         从 InnoDB 逻辑存储结构来看,所有的数据都被逻辑存放在一个空间中,这个空间就叫做表空间(tablespace)。表空间由 (segment)、(e
转载 2023-12-13 06:46:50
69阅读
询到数据,因为索引和数据存储在一个数据块中,
转载 2019-06-21 16:20:00
124阅读
2评论
1.一共有八大数据结构分类  a.数组  b.栈  c.队列  d.链表(单链表、双向链表、循环链表)  c.数  f.散列表  g.堆  h.图如图: 1、数组数组是可以再内存中连续存储多个元素结构,在内存中分配也是连续,数组中元素通过数组下标进行访问,数组下标从0开始。例如下面这段代码就是将数组第一个元素赋值为 1。1 int[] data = new int[100];d
一、介绍数据块(Block):数据块是oracle存储单位,也叫逻辑块,oracle块,是物理磁盘一个空间。(Extent):一组数据块构成一个(Segment):由一组构成,被分配到一个特定数据结构中,只能存储于一个表空间中,不能跨越表空间存储当构成一个所有空间满了后,系统需要分配其他给该段以便存储数据,这些新增可能是临近也可能不是临近以及构成所有
转载 精选 2013-08-17 16:30:57
998阅读
单选题1.删除数据表中一条记录用以下哪一项(   )A、DELETEDB、DELETEC、 DROPD、 UPDATE正确答案:B2.修改数据库表结构用以下哪一项(   )A、UPDATEB、CREATEC、UPDATEDD、ALTER正确答案:D3.主键建立有(   )种方法A、一B、四C、二D、三正确答案:D4
转载 2024-06-11 13:52:02
66阅读
MySQLInnoDB存储引擎逻辑存储结构和Oracle大致相同,所有数据都被逻辑地存放在一个空间中,我们称之为表空间(tablespace)。表空间又由(segment)、(extent)、页(page)组成。InnoDB存储引擎逻辑存储结构大致如下图所示。 下面重点到了一下MySQL InnoDB和页。 点击这里查看视频讲解:【赵渝强老师】:MySQL I
原创 2月前
65阅读
1、数据库由一个或多个表空间组成。2、表空间由一个或多个数据文件组成,这些文件可以是文件系统中cooked文件、原始分区(裸设备)、ASM或集群上文件。3、(table、index等)由一个或多个组成,在表空间中,因为可能分布在表空间中不同数据文件上,所以可能包含一个表空间上多个数据文件上数据,另一般创建一个对象便会创建一个,占用存储空间每一个对象都会对应一个,如创建一个表
原创 2013-11-28 17:29:31
2226阅读
1. 表空间是InnoDB存储引擎逻辑结构最高层,所有的数据都存放在表空间
原创 2022-11-15 15:07:52
62阅读
java栈、堆、方法详解1、java中栈(stack)和堆(heap)是java在内存(ram)中存放数据地方2、堆     存储全部是对象,每个对象都包含一个与之对应class信息。(class目的是得到操作指令);     jvm只有一个heap,被所有线程共享,不存放基本类型和对象引用,只存放对
目录1、mysql索引1.1、索引结构1.2、页结构:1.3 索引结构b+tree2、聚集索引与非聚集索引3、什么是回表4、什么是索引覆盖(解决回表方法)5、 uuid与自增int型id性能上对比 1、mysql索引1.1、索引结构MySQL基本存储结构是页(记录都存在页里面),各个数据页可以组成一个双向链表,每个数据页都会为存储在它里面的记录生成一个页目录,每个数据页中内容又可以组
简介 我们程序运行时候都是放在内存里、根据静态、成员函数、代码、对象、等等、放在不同内存分块里、大概分为5块 1 栈 2 堆 3 BSS-全局-(静态) 4 代码 5 数
转载 2021-08-05 17:49:10
3356阅读
方法内部结构1.概述2.方法存储什么3.方法内部结构4.运行时常量池5.为什么需要常量池6.常量池中有什么7.总结
原创 2021-08-14 00:43:04
247阅读
Oracle 逻辑结构 ( 表空间、、区间、块 ) ——   数据是一系列区间 , 在这个特定逻辑存储结构存储数据都在一个表空间内 . 例如对于每一种数据库 对象 ( 表、索引 ) ,数据库都会分配一个或一区间构成其对象数据。 A segment is a set of extents that contains all the data for a spec
原创 2009-10-22 11:13:00
1464阅读
#define _CRT_SECURE_NO_WARNINGS 1 #include<stdio.h>  //位也是一种结构体类型,但有两个不同 //1.位成员必须是int、unsigned int 或者signed int //2.位成员名后有一个冒号和一个数字。 //3.位时不支持跨平台 struct S  { int a: 2;//冒号后面的值
原创 2023-04-08 08:01:23
75阅读
一个程序运行是需要内存,那么我们平常写程序内存都是怎么分配呢?都是在一起存放?还是分开?按照什么规律呢?预备知识: (1)首先我们要知道,内存是真实存在,内存是一个物理器件。它时由操作系统管理,我们平常只要使用它就行了,为了方便管理。操作系统提供了很多种机制来管理内存,每一种机制都有其特点。 (2)三种内存来源:栈(stack)、堆(heap)、数据(data)
转载 2017-07-07 10:50:15
1617阅读
  • 1
  • 2
  • 3
  • 4
  • 5